PEOPLE v. JACKSON

104570.

104 A.D.3d 993 (2013)

960 N.Y.S.2d 336

2013 NY Slip Op 1577

TH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, Respondent, v. SKYLER JACKSON, Appellant.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Third Department.

March 14, 2013.


In satisfaction of a pending two-count felony indictment, defendant pleaded guilty to a prosecutor's information charging a single misdemeanor count of assault in the third degree. In accordance with the plea agreement, he was sentenced to time served. This appeal ensued.
